Urgent Medical Appeal

Stand By Sahithi's Father

A fundraiser by K. Sahithi, ITES Trainer at Nirmaan, for her father's urgent surgery and recovery

Sahithi's father, K. Madhukar (49 years old) has long been the quiet backbone of his family, working as a car driver and serving as the primary earner. That changed when he was diagnosed with mesenteric vein thrombosis, where blood clot in a vein carrying blood from his intestine cut off circulation to part of his small intestine. That portion has since become non-viable, causing persistent vomiting, hiccups, and a sharp decline in his health. After medication and tests confirmed the severity of his condition, doctors at Apollo Hospital, Secunderabad advised urgent surgery.

Recovery will unfold in stages — surgery, close post-operative monitoring, and nutritional rebuilding

— so the family can't yet say how many weeks it will take. What's certain is that support is needed now, and will likely be needed continuously through recovery. Sahithi began her career only about a year ago and is still building financial independence; with her father unable to work, she has suddenly become her family's sole support while facing costs running into several lakhs.
